janusgraph的简单使用

当安装好以后简单的使用janusgraph

1.进入janusgraph的shell命令界面

[root@had214 janusgraph-0.3.1-hadoop2]# bin/gremlin.sh

2.使用janusgraph自带的一个gods图库进行简单的操作

god图

  

  2.1打开一个janusgraph的实例,类似于spark-shell中得sparksession,open中写的是janusgraph的配置信息

  graph=JanusGraphFactory.open('conf/gremlin-server/janusgraph-hbase-es.properties')

  2.2使用自带的方法加载内部的方法

  GraphOfTheGodsFactory.load(graph)  

  2.3遍历数据

  g = graph.traversal()

  2.4获取节点名字为saturn的位置

  saturn = g.V().has('name', 'saturn').next()

  2.5获取staturn的属性

  g.V(saturn).valueMap()

  2.6通过图数据库中得关系进行查找到staturn的爷爷是谁

  g.V(saturn).in('father').in('father').values('name')

最新文章

  1. nodeJS(express4.x)+vue(vue-cli)构建前后端分离详细教程(带跨域)
  2. iOS UIButton单双击处理响应不同的方法
  3. PHP的PSR系列规范都有啥内容
  4. onMeasure流程解析
  5. 一组PHP可逆加密解密算法
  6. webapi输入验证过滤器ValidationActionFilter
  7. [linux笔记]理清linux安装程序用到的(configure, make, make install)
  8. SQLite常用网址
  9. 使用git自动将子工程发布到百度开放云上
  10. Delphi 记事本 TMemo(5篇)
  11. 使用Navicat或PLSQL客户端工具连接远程Oracle数据库(本地无需安装oracle)
  12. 三 Struts2 添加返回数据
  13. VS2010创建MVC4项目提示错误: 此模板尝试加载组件程序集 “NuGet.VisualStudio.Interop, Version=1.0.0.0, Culture=neutral,
  14. Django 分组 聚合
  15. java sort排序原理
  16. MySQL利用binlog恢复误操作数据(python脚本)
  17. 【漏洞复现】ES File Explorer Open Port Vulnerability - CVE-2019-6447
  18. error: illegal character '\ufeff' 的解决方案
  19. Java_Certificates does not conform to algorithm constraints
  20. winform 控件没有Cursor属性时的处理办法

热门文章

  1. Versioning information could not be retrieved from the NuGet package repository. Please try again later.
  2. libevent源码分析三--signal事件响应
  3. spark提交任务详解
  4. appium_获取元素状态
  5. golang ---cron
  6. IIS err_connection_timed_out(响应时间过长)
  7. JAVA基础之事务
  8. JAVA基础之JSP与EL技术、JSTL技术
  9. Celery:Next Steps
  10. 利用chocolatey软件包管理工具安装yarn,比npm更快更稳定